"Echoes of Tomorrow"

In the year 2073, the world had transformed in ways that were both awe-inspiring and challenging. Technological advancements had propelled humanity into a new era, but not without raising profound questions about the nature of progress, ethics, and identity.

The cities of the past seemed like quaint relics compared to the sprawling metropolises of the future. Tall skyscrapers reached into the sky, adorned with gardens and green spaces that floated between the layers of glass and steel. Transportation had undergone a revolutionary shift; flying cars zipped through the air in organized lanes, while efficient underground hyperloops connected cities across continents in a matter of minutes.

But amid this dazzling progress, a new consciousness had taken root. Mind-Link, a revolutionary brain-computer interface, allowed individuals to access information instantaneously and communicate telepathically. This innovation had sparked debates about the erosion of privacy and individuality, yet it also opened avenues for unprecedented collaboration and empathy.

The natural world, however, had suffered greatly. Climate change had forced humanity to confront its own impact on the environment. As a result, efforts were made to restore ecosystems and develop sustainable technologies. Massive bio-domes housed entire rainforests and coral reefs, serving as both conservation efforts and reminders of the beauty that had once existed.

In the realm of health, medical science had achieved wonders. Nanobots coursed through people's bodies, constantly monitoring and repairing cells to extend lifespans beyond a century. Diseases that had once been death sentences were now manageable or even eradicated. However, debates raged about the implications of extending life, with some arguing that it allowed the privileged to amass even more power and resources.

Artificial intelligence had evolved into a force that touched every aspect of life. AI-driven androids assisted in tasks ranging from everyday chores to complex medical procedures. They were designed to resemble humans, both in appearance and emotion, leading to discussions about the boundaries between organic and artificial life.

The global political landscape had also shifted. Nations had given way to multi-national coalitions and alliances, with the United Earth Council acting as a central governing body. This shift, while promoting global unity, had also led to cultural clashes and the need to find common ground among diverse societies.

Through all these changes, one fundamental aspect of humanity remained constant: the pursuit of meaning. With basic needs met, people turned to explore the frontiers of creativity, philosophy, and spirituality. Virtual reality realms allowed individuals to craft their own dreamscapes, blurring the lines between reality and imagination.

As society looked back on the past, they found themselves grappling with the question of whether progress had truly brought happiness. Some longed for the simplicity of bygone eras, while others embraced the boundless possibilities of the future. In the end, the view of the world after 50 years was a complex tapestry of triumphs and challenges, a testament to humanity's unyielding spirit to shape their destiny, no matter how uncertain the path may be.
